Abstract

In one or more embodiments, one or more systems, methods, and/or processes may determine an engagement of a power supply unit with at least one of an information handling system (IHS) and a chassis configured to house multiple information handling systems (IHSs); may provide a power at a first voltage to the at least one of the IHS and the chassis; may determine if the at least one of the IHS and the chassis utilizes a second voltage; if the at least one of the IHS and the chassis utilizes the second voltage, may determine if the power supply unit is configured to provide the power at the second voltage; and if the power supply unit is configured to provide the power at the second voltage, may provide the power at the second voltage to the at least one of the IHS and the chassis.

Claims (33)

1. A chassis, comprising:

an information handling system (IHS) comprising a plurality of components; and

a first power supply unit (PSU) comprising:

at least one processor;

a power controller device;

a power supply controller coupled to a current source; and

a memory medium, coupled to the at least one processor, that stores instructions executable by the at least one processor, which when executed by the at least one processor, cause the first PSU to:

provide power at a first voltage to the IHS;

determine if the IHS utilizes power at a second voltage greater than the first voltage, wherein the determining comprises the power supply controller (PSC) communicating with the current source to provide a first current to a resistor in the IHS and measuring the voltage across the resistor;

if the IHS utilizes power at the second voltage:

determine if the first PSU is configurable to provide the power at the second voltage; wherein

if the first PSU is configurable to provide power at the second voltage, communicate with the power controller device to provide power at the second voltage to the IHS, wherein the second voltage is associated with providing power to one or more graphics processing units (GPU)s; and

if the first PSU is not configurable to provide power at the second voltage, provide information indicating that the first PSU is not configurable to provide power at the second voltage; and

if the IHS does not utilize power at the second voltage:

determine if the first PSU is configured to provide power at the first voltage;

if the first PSU is configured to provide power at the first voltage, provide power at the first voltage to the IHS; and

if the first PSU is not configured to provide power at the first voltage, provide information indicating that the first PSU is not configured to provide power at the first voltage.
